The Teliani Valley Kakhuri No.8 Amber Dry is a special wine from Georgia, originating from the famous Kakheti wine region, situated at the foot of the majestic Caucasus. This region is known for its centuries-old vineyard traditions and indigenous grape varieties, which give this wine its characteristic taste and amber color. The wine is a blend of four traditional Georgian white grapes: Rkatsiteli (40%), Kakhuri Mtsvane (40%), Khikhvi (10%), and Kisi (10%). These carefully selected grapes are harvested from their own vineyards in the Manavi microzone (Rkatsiteli and Kakhuri Mtsvane) and in the Akhmeta region (Kisi and Khikhvi).
The Teliani Valley Kakhuri No.8 Amber Dry is produced according to the traditional Kakheti method. After harvesting, the grapes undergo alcoholic fermentation with skin contact for 7 to 10 days, which ensures the characteristic amber color and enhanced aromas. Subsequently, a secondary malolactic fermentation takes place for 15 days, after which the wine ages on the skins for another 6 months. This process gives the wine a fuller body, soft tannins, and harmonious complexity. The wine has an alcohol content of 12.5%.
